These glamorous, ceramic, cutesy figural vases got their start in florist shops during the 1950s and again in the middle 1960s. Today they are wildly popular among collectors, and this is a wonderful pocket guide. The 300 vases, illustrated in color, include dimensions and current values in the captions. Manufacturers include Napco, Royal Copley, Royal Sealy, Shawnee, and many others.
